Inclusion is a key pillar of ESA’s mission, and in 2025 we launched an Equality, Diversity & Inclusion (EDI) strategy. It began with an industry survey, focusing on how the experience of professionals can differ depending on their ethnicity, the results of which you can read below. This led to two events being scheduled for April and May 2026, along with the publication of a ‘toolkit for change’.
This page will be updated as ESA’s EDI strategy is continuously developed and as measures are implemented.

YOUR TOOLKIT FOR CHANGE
The ESA Organisational Culture Self-Assessment Tool (2026) is designed to help organisations reflect on how inclusion shows up in their culture. Whether used in a team meeting or a facilitated workshop, the toolkit invites discussion about what’s working, what’s missing, and what small steps could make a difference.
